1. Specifications Comparison
Feature | Honor X8a | Apple iPhone 15 Pro |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Design | |||
Dimensions (mm) | 162.9 x 74.5 x 7.5 | 146.6 x 70.6 x 8.3 | iPhone 15 Pro is noticeably smaller and slightly thicker. More pocketable and one-hand usable. |
Weight (g) | 179 | 187 | Negligible weight difference in real-world usage. |
Build | Titanium frame | iPhone 15 Pro boasts a more premium and durable build. | |
Display | |||
Display Type | IPS LCD | LTPO Super Retina XDR OLED | iPhone 15 Pro offers superior contrast, deeper blacks, and potentially better power efficiency due to LTPO. |
Display Size (inches) | 6.7 | 6.1 | Honor X8a provides a larger screen for media consumption, but iPhone 15 Pro's smaller size benefits one-handed use. |
Resolution (px) | 1080 x 2388 | 1179 x 2556 | iPhone 15 Pro has a sharper display with higher pixel density (461 ppi vs 391 ppi). |
Refresh Rate (Hz) | 90 | 120 | iPhone 15 Pro offers smoother scrolling and animations with its higher refresh rate. |
HDR | No Dolby Vision | Dolby Vision | iPhone 15 Pro supports Dolby Vision for a wider range of colors and higher dynamic range in compatible content. |
Peak Brightness(nits) | Not specified | 2000 | Missing peak brightness for Honor X8a makes outdoor visibility comparison difficult. iPhone 15 Pro's high brightness ensures excellent sunlight readability. |
Performance | |||
Chipset | Mediatek Helio G88 (12nm) | Apple A17 Pro (3nm) | iPhone 15 Pro's A17 Pro chip offers significantly faster processing, smoother graphics, and better power efficiency due to the advanced 3nm process. |
CPU | Octa-core (2x2.0 GHz Cortex-A75 & 6x1.8 GHz Cortex-A55) | Hexa-core (2x3.78 GHz + 4x2.11 GHz) | A17 Pro's architecture and higher clock speeds translate to much faster performance in demanding tasks and multitasking. |
GPU | Mali-G52 MC2 | Apple GPU (6-core) | iPhone 15 Pro's GPU offers a substantial leap in graphics performance, beneficial for gaming and graphically intensive applications. |
RAM | 6GB/8GB | 8GB | Both offer ample RAM for most users, although more RAM options on the Honor X8a might appeal to some. |
Camera | |||
Main Camera (MP) | 100 | 48 | Higher megapixel count on Honor X8a doesn't guarantee better image quality. iPhone's larger sensor and advanced image processing typically result in superior photos. |
Video Recording | 1080p@30fps | Up to 4K@60fps with Dolby Vision HDR | iPhone 15 Pro offers significantly better video recording capabilities with higher resolution, frame rates, and HDR support. |
DXOMARK Score | Not Available | 154 (Mobile), 149 (Selfie) | DXOMARK scores suggest significantly better overall camera performance on the iPhone 15 Pro. |
Battery | |||
Capacity (mAh) | 4500 | 3274(Rumored 3650) | Honor X8a has a larger battery capacity, potentially leading to longer battery life. However, real-world usage depends on optimization. iPhone's smaller battery may be offset by its more efficient chip. |
Fast Charging | 22.5W | 27W | iPhone 15 Pro offers slightly faster wired charging. |
2. Key Differences Analysis
Honor X8a Advantages:
- Larger Display: Better for media consumption.
- Potentially Longer Battery Life: Higher battery capacity suggests longer usage, though real-world performance varies.
- Lower Price: Significantly more affordable.
iPhone 15 Pro Advantages:
- Significantly Faster Performance: The A17 Pro chip provides a massive performance advantage.
- Superior Display Quality: OLED with HDR, higher resolution, and refresh rate delivers a much better visual experience.
- Premium Build Quality: Titanium frame ensures durability and a premium feel.
- Better Camera System: Consistently produces high-quality photos and videos.
- Faster Charging: Charges slightly faster than Honor x8a
3. User Profiles & Recommendations
Honor X8a: Budget-conscious users prioritizing a large display for media consumption and long battery life. Suitable for casual gaming and everyday tasks.
iPhone 15 Pro: Users who demand top-tier performance, a premium experience, and excellent camera capabilities. Ideal for demanding tasks, gaming, content creation, and those valuing a polished user experience.
